    HP Omen X 35 review

    The HP Omen X 35 pairs its large, curved design with the form of extravagant branding that we’ve come to count on from HP’s high-end gaming vary.

    HP’s Omen units haven’t at all times delivered prior to now, although, with excessive costs and little attraction past the aesthetics – so we’re to see how this display screen handles an more and more crowded market.

    The HP Omen X 35 does get off to an excellent begin, nonetheless. Its 1800R curve is commonplace, and it really works properly by offering an more and more immersive viewing angle. The three,440 x 1,440 decision is nice, too – it’s the present sweet-spot for offering loads of element with out working graphics playing cards too laborious.

    Value and availability

    There’s no avoiding the excessive worth, although. The Omen X will set you again round £882 or $799 – or greater than AU$1,500. That’s a number of instances dearer than standard 16:9 gaming screens.

    Each of the HP’s keenest rivals provide aggressive costs, though they do fluctuate relying on which facet of the Atlantic you’re on. The AOC Agon AG352UCG6 is a 35in display screen with a 1440p decision, and it’ll set you again £735 within the UK however $870 within the US.

    The BenQ EX3501R is one other 35in panel and is essentially the most reasonably priced out of the three we’ve talked about right here. Within the UK it’s simply £625, whereas in America it’ll price you $799.

    Design and options

    The HP Omen X 35 appears to be like extra outlandish than a lot of the different screens in the marketplace. As a substitute of utilizing the skinny, nondescript legs that rivals depend on, the Omen sits on an attention grabbing metallic sq..

    The sq. base panel appears to be like totally different, and it’s arguably simpler to make use of than if it had broad, spindly legs – because it makes it simpler to place the huge HP on a mean desk.

    The sq. base sits beneath a slim, rectangular stand that has a headphone hook and a cable-routing loop, and the display screen’s peak will be adjusted by sliding the panel up and down the stand. The display screen can tilt forwards and backwards, too.

    The HP Omen X 35 actually appears to be like extra arresting than a few of its rivals. The extra reasonably priced BenQ EX3501R is simply as giant, however its metallic stand and base are plain. The AOC Agon AG352UCG6 is darker, with black metallic used all through, nevertheless it’s nonetheless not as eye-catching because the HP Omen. Nonetheless, remember that the AOC does have a swivelling stand, so it is a bit more versatile.

    The HP Omen X 35’s eager sense of fashion continues to the display screen itself. Three of the bezels are slim – the fourth is wider as a result of the brand – and the panel has ambient lighting that replicates the color profile of on-screen content material. This characteristic is designed to make the display screen simpler to view in darkish rooms, and the lighting will also be tuned to a selected color, or disabled completely.

    The HP Omen X 35 has glorious construct high quality all through, however this can be very heavy. It suggestions the scales at 26 kilos – the AOC is somewhat lighter, whereas the BenQ undercuts each at 23 kilos. The HP can also be practically 33 inches broad and 16 inches tall, so it’s hardly delicate both.

    Get past the aesthetics and the HP Omen X 35 serves up a stable specification. On the rear you’ve bought HDMI 1.four and DisplayPort 1.2, which give ample bandwidth for the display screen’s three,440 x 1,440 decision. The Omen additionally has three USB three.zero connectors and a headphone jack.

    The ports face outwards, however they’re awkward to entry as they’re positioned between the stand and the display screen. It’s particularly tough if you wish to ceaselessly use the USB ports – it will have been good to have one, at the very least, on the facet of the display screen. There’s no deal with, both, and no audio system.

    These are admittedly minor flaws, however they’re all price contemplating if you wish to spend this a lot cash. It’s additionally price remembering that the cheaper BenQ has USB-C and HDR – neither of which comes included on the HP.

    On the within you get 100Hz Nvidia G-Sync. That’s a stable determine, however the AOC panel has G-Sync that tops out at 120Hz, whereas the BenQ makes do with 100Hz AMD FreeSync.

    The HP Omen X 35’s 100Hz peak does imply gaming is easy on this display screen, however the AOC is best on this regard. And, regardless of which panel you choose, concentrate on the graphical grunt required: to run video games at 100fps and past on a three,440 x 1,440 display screen, you’ll want a GTX 1080 Ti or equal.

    The HP’s panel makes use of VA expertise, which is identical sort of because the AOC and BenQ panels. That’s unsurprising, as VA screens usually ship nice distinction. All three of the screens we’ve talked about right here even have a 4ms response time.

    The Omen is managed by a wise, snappy on-screen show. It’s managed by three shallow buttons on the right-hand facet of the monitor. The menus are intuitive and at all times quick, with choices displayed sensibly.

    Efficiency

    The HP Omen X 35 delivered persistently good picture high quality, nevertheless it simply falls wanting true greatness.

    Take the manufacturing unit brightness degree of 279cd/m2. It’s good, and simply excessive sufficient to deal with gaming in regular conditions and beneath vivid lights. Nonetheless, it doesn’t match the HP’s quoted 300cd/m2 determine, and the display screen’s black degree of zero.16cd/m2 isn’t nearly as good as another screens we’ve seen.

    These two numbers mix for a distinction ratio of 1,738:1. That, once more, is a wonderful determine – nevertheless it’s unable to match HP’s spec sheet.

    However, that spectacular distinction nonetheless permits this display screen to serve up very good vibrancy at each level of the color spectrum, in addition to delicate adjustments in colors throughout the board. That’s vital in relation to making video games look punchy and correct, regardless of the colors they’re producing.

    The HP Omen X 35 has an excellent common Delta E of 1.82 – beneath the vital determine of two the place the human eye can’t inform the distinction. The colour temperature of 6,418Okay is nice, too, with barely any deviation from the perfect determine of 6,500Okay. Each figures be sure that the HP delivers nice colour accuracy, and the panel’s sRGB gamut protection degree of 98.7% is great. Briefly: colours in video games and films will look correct, and there gained’t be any video games that the Omen gained’t be capable to deal with.

    Uniformity was solely common, although. The panel’s backlight different by 13% on the left-hand edge and 15% on the right-hand facet. It is a widespread challenge with widescreen screens, and people figures gained’t trigger issues except you’re doing work that’s extraordinarily color- and contrast-sensitive.

    Our remaining check, enter lag, is vital for gaming. On this check the HP Omen X 35 returned a mean response pace of 14.2ms. Something beneath 20ms is good for gaming, and even for aggressive play, so there are not any points right here.

    As regular, don’t trouble with the genre-specific display screen modes included on the HP Omen X 35. The Omen has totally different choices for RTS, racing and FPS video games, however they improved distinction whereas ruining color accuracy. Distinction is already glorious, in order that’s not a trade-off we’d take into account.

    Verdict

    The  HP Omen X 35  has a number of tempting attributes. The design is great, and it has crammed in a high-quality panel with an enormous decision and 100Hz Nvidia G-Sync.

    Its benchmark outcomes are spectacular, and even when it misses the mark it’s by no means by a lot: the poorer uniformity gained’t impression day-to-day use, and the game-specific modes are simply prevented.

    The HP Omen X 35 simply has sufficient high quality to make video games and movies look unbelievable. It’ll look good in your desk whereas doing it, too.

    Nonetheless, a few of these benchmark outcomes may have been somewhat higher, and rivals do provide superior specs: the AOC has improved G-Sync, whereas BenQ’s cheaper display screen has FreeSync, HDR and extra ports.

    The worth is somewhat excessive, too. In most nations the HP can be somewhat dearer than the AOC and BenQ panels, and it doesn’t justify the additional expense apart from with its stable appears to be like and attention-grabbing branding.

    Total, the HP Omen X 35 is an outstanding monitor, with good display screen high quality and a stable set of options. It’s actually price shopping for for those who’re trying to find a handsome gaming display screen that may again up its design with vivid, correct pictures. It’s costly, although, and your cash will go additional elsewhere for those who’re prepared to surrender the high-end appears to be like and Omen model.
